Solon Community Living (SCL) offers a groundbreaking living arrangement for adults with disabilities in Solon, made up of 14 apartments for residents, with on-site caregiving staff living in the community. But the SCL also offers a unique opportunity for college and graduate students to learn about caring for those with disabilities through a program, called the Resident Assistant program.

In June, as the first four adult residents moved into SCL, and at the same time, two resident assistants, Gabby Rapposelli, 22, and Emma Van Winkle, 20, also began their tenure there…
